Considering your question, you should be taking the set in to a service shop
to have proper safe and reliable service for your set.

You have to have a good solid knowledge of TV electronics theory, and
service experience to service your set. You will have to get the service
manual, and follow through with a scope and DVM. That is how you will be
able to find the defective parts! It is very difficult just from a picture
to know exactly what parts are the cause. There are many parts in the
horizontal scan circuits that can cause this type of fault.

There is a possibility that the fault is in an area that is referred to as
the pin-amp circuit. It works with both the horizontal and vertical
deflection amplifiers.
